Online resources: Summary: This comprehensive textbook on financial accounting, authored by John Hoggett, John Medlin, Keryn Chalmers, Claire Beattie, Andreas Hellmann, and Jodie Maxfield, is designed for educational purposes, specifically targeting students and professionals in accounting and finance. The book covers key areas such as decision making, financial statements, transaction recording, and the complete accounting cycle. It provides insights into accounting systems, ethics, and the roles of management and financial accounting.
